BOTZ earthenware glazes are available ready to use in 200ml jars. Stir the glaze thoroughly and apply 2-3 coats. The glaze soon dries allowing the pots to be lifted into the kiln. For best results allow the glaze to dry for a day before firing.
Results will vary depending on thickness of glaze, clay applied, shape of vessel and final firing temperature.
The ideal firing temperature is around 1020°C with a 20 minute soak.
Glaze finish: Glossy
- Very intensive mediterranean blue
- Works also on dark clay
- Becomes matt by 1040°C
- Experiment: less colour stable and more silky when fired to higher temperatures
